Napa Man Accused Of Choking Paraplegic Father In Family Argument

NAPA (CBS SF) – A Napa man in a fight with his brother allegedly assaulted his paraplegic father who tried to break up the fight Wednesday afternoon, a police captain said.

Daniel Romero Pena, 24, pushed his brother during an argument around 1:50 p.m. at a residence in the 1500 block of Parkwood Street, Napa police Capt. Jeff Troendly said.

Pena grabbed his 58-year-old father's throat and squeezed it for several seconds, causing redness to his father's neck, Troendly said.

Pena fled but returned to the residence around 4 p.m. Officers responded when Pena's mother called police and arrested Pena without incident, Troendly said.

The Napa Fire Department evaluated Pena's father's injuries and the elder Pena said he would seek his own medical attention, according to Troendly.

Daniel Pena was booked into Napa County Jail on suspicion of abuse of an elder or dependent adult and for outstanding warrants for DUI, Troendly said.
